Isaac Newton:
Newton Project – a large and very successful project of digitizing Newton\’s manuscripts from Cambridge University Library. Its focus is upon theological manuscripts, but contains a large section of scientific manuscripts, books about Newton\’s philosophy written by his contemporaries. The volume of the digitized materials is growing every week.
